If you prefer a dedicated server vs VPS, you can look at the packages Sago
offers (based out of Tampa)- dedicated servers starting at $50/month.
http://www.sagonet.com/bargain-servers.html
I currently use them and have no complaints, i get a full server to myself,
root access, no closed ports etc.... And the service has been awesome as
long as i've been with them..

> > Our application is near to a public release and we also decided to ge a
> > VPS. Our option was IPower, to be more specific,
> > http://ipower.com/virtual_20gbpackage.html it has worked fine for us
> > during development, I have Red5 0.6.3 and CVS for group development,
> > both installed by myself. The only problem I have had is that they have
> > some ports closed so i cannot use the standar ports. No big deal.
